33var app = angular . module ( 'app' , [ ] ) ;
44
55
6- /*
6+
7+
78app . config ( [ '$interpolateProvider' ,
89 function ( $interpolateProvider ) {
910 $interpolateProvider . startSymbol ( '[[' ) ;
1011 $interpolateProvider . endSymbol ( ']]' ) ;
1112 } ] ) ;
12- */
1313
1414
1515app . directive ( 'fileModel' , [ '$parse' , function ( $parse ) {
@@ -32,9 +32,23 @@ app.directive('fileModel',['$parse', function($parse) {
3232} ] ) ;
3333
3434
35+ function logEvent ( str ) {
36+ console . log ( str ) ;
37+ var d = document . createElement ( 'div' ) ;
38+ d . innerHTML = str ;
39+ document . getElementById ( 'result' ) . appendChild ( d ) ;
40+ }
41+ function objToString ( obj ) {
42+ var str = '' ;
43+ for ( var p in obj ) {
44+ if ( obj . hasOwnProperty ( p ) ) {
45+ str += p + '::' + obj [ p ] + '\n' ;
46+ }
47+ }
48+ }
3549
36- app . service ( 'fileUpload' , [ '$http' , '$scope' ,
37- function ( $http , $scope ) {
50+ app . service ( 'fileUpload' , [ '$http' ,
51+ function ( $http ) {
3852 this . uploadFileToUrl = function ( file ) {
3953 var fd = new FormData ( ) ;
4054 fd . append ( 'file' , file ) ;
@@ -43,11 +57,12 @@ app.service('fileUpload',['$http','$scope',
4357 headers : { 'Content-Type' : undefined }
4458 } )
4559 . success ( function ( responseid ) {
60+ logEvent ( JSON . stringify ( responseid ) ) ;
4661 } )
4762 . error ( function ( ) {
4863 } ) ;
4964
50- }
65+ } ;
5166} ] ) ;
5267
5368
0 commit comments